The Enduring Legacy and Modern Rebirth of the Motorola Razr

To understand the strategic significance of the upcoming Razr 2026 series, it is essential to contextualize Motorola’s journey in the mobile phone industry, particularly its iconic Razr brand. The original Motorola Razr V3, launched in 2004, was more than just a phone; it was a cultural phenomenon. Its ultra-slim profile, metallic finish, and distinctive flip design made it a fashion statement and a technological marvel of its time, selling over 130 million units globally and cementing Motorola’s position at the forefront of mobile innovation. This legacy of design-forward, clamshell devices provides a powerful brand heritage that Motorola has consciously sought to leverage in the modern era of smartphones.

The advent of flexible display technology offered a unique opportunity for Motorola to resurrect the Razr brand in a truly innovative form: the foldable smartphone. In 2019, Motorola introduced its first foldable Razr, aiming to capture the nostalgia of its predecessor while pushing the boundaries of smartphone design. This initial foray was met with mixed reviews, primarily due to concerns about hinge durability, battery life, and a premium price point that struggled to justify its specifications against traditional flagship devices. Nevertheless, it marked Motorola’s courageous entry into a nascent market dominated by a few key players.

Since then, Motorola has demonstrated a clear commitment to refining its foldable strategy. Subsequent iterations, such as the Razr 5G (2020), Razr 2022, and the Razr+ (known as Razr Ultra in some markets) and Razr 2023 (known as Razr in some markets) lines, have shown a steady progression in design, durability, and performance. The company has increasingly adopted a two-tiered approach, offering a premium "Ultra" or "Plus" model alongside a more accessible standard Razr variant. This strategy allows Motorola to target both high-end consumers seeking the latest innovations and a broader audience interested in the unique form factor at a more competitive price point. The Razr+ 2023, for instance, received considerable acclaim for its large external display, improved hinge mechanism, and enhanced internal specifications, signalling Motorola’s growing maturity in the foldable segment. Navigating Economic Headwinds: The Global RAM Crisis and its Implications

A significant factor that could shape the Razr 2026 series, particularly its pricing, is the ongoing global "RAM crisis." This refers to a period of heightened demand and constrained supply within the dynamic random-access memory (DRAM) market, leading to increased component costs for electronics manufacturers worldwide. Several interconnected factors contribute to this crisis:

  1. Surging Demand: The proliferation of artificial intelligence (AI) applications, particularly large language models (LLMs) and generative AI, requires immense computational power and, consequently, vast amounts of high-bandwidth memory. Data centers, cloud computing services, and AI research institutions are driving unprecedented demand for advanced DRAM modules.
  2. Increased Smartphone Memory Requirements: Modern flagship smartphones, especially those incorporating on-device AI capabilities and advanced multitasking features, are equipped with increasingly larger amounts of RAM (e.g., 8GB, 12GB, 16GB). This trend consumes a substantial portion of the global DRAM supply.
  3. Supply Chain Complexities: The semiconductor industry, including DRAM manufacturing, is highly capital-intensive and involves complex global supply chains. Geopolitical tensions, trade disputes, and even natural disasters in key manufacturing regions can disrupt production and logistics, leading to shortages.
  4. Manufacturing Bottlenecks: Producing advanced DRAM chips requires state-of-the-art fabrication plants (fabs) and highly specialized equipment. Expanding production capacity is a lengthy and expensive process, often taking years from planning to full operation, making it difficult for supply to quickly respond to sudden spikes in demand.
  5. Inflationary Pressures: Broader global inflationary trends, including rising energy costs, raw material prices, and labour expenses, also contribute to the overall increase in semiconductor component costs.

For Motorola, this RAM crisis translates directly into higher bills of material (BOM) for its upcoming devices. Why Bundling is an Effective Strategy:

  • Increased Perceived Value: Offering valuable accessories like styluses, smartwatches, or tracking tags alongside the phone makes the overall purchase feel like a better deal, even if the base price of the phone itself is higher. Consumers often mentally aggregate the value of the bundle rather than focusing solely on the phone’s individual price.
  • Ecosystem Expansion: Bundling encourages consumers to adopt Motorola’s broader ecosystem of accessories and smart devices. This can lead to increased customer loyalty and future purchases within the brand. For instance, a Moto Watch user is more likely to consider a Motorola phone for seamless integration.
  • Differentiation from Competitors: In a crowded market, unique bundling offers can help Motorola stand out. While competitors might focus solely on device specifications, Motorola can present a holistic lifestyle package.
  • Softening Price Sensitivity: For a foldable phone commanding a premium price, bundling can act as a psychological buffer. A £1,799.99 phone discounted to £1,579.99 with a "free" Moto Pen Ultra feels more attractive than just a £1,579.99 phone, even if the effective cost is similar.
  • Targeted Appeal: Different bundles can cater to various consumer needs. A stylus appeals to productivity users, a smartwatch to fitness enthusiasts, and a tracking tag to those concerned with device security.
